LAS VEGAS, May 26, 2023 ~ Allegiant and the International Brotherhood of Teamsters (IBT) have ratified a new two-year contract extension for the company's flight dispatchers. The agreement was approved by 95.8% of the dispatchers, who currently number 50.
Greg Anderson, President of Allegiant, expressed his satisfaction with the outcome: "We are pleased to see our dispatchers overwhelmingly voted to ratify the tentative agreement we presented a few weeks ago. This extension comes more than a year before the current contract's amendable date, thanks to the hard work and dedication of the negotiating teams for both Allegiant and IBT. Our team of dispatchers play a critical role in our operations, and we appreciate their overwhelming approval and commitment to this process."

The current collective bargaining agreement became effective on April 25, 2019 and was scheduled to become amendable on May 31, 2024. However, early off-the-record discussions between both parties resulted in a tentative agreement that replaced the original rate increases scheduled for May 31 this year with two additional years addressing rate changes only.
Las Vegas-based Allegiant is an integrated travel company with an airline at its heart that focuses on connecting customers with people, places and experiences that matter most. Since 1999, Allegiant Air has provided travelers in small-to-medium cities with all-nonstop flights at industry-low average fares.
